On this day – July 4

Posted on July 4, 2024June 15, 2024 By Barb Sande

The events on this day in history for our heritage companies are noted below.

The earliest event was in 1982, the latest event was in 2006

No milestone events (5 to 65+ years ago)

Human Spaceflight:

1982 – LANDING: STS-4 (Columbia), Edwards AFB

2006 – LAUNCH: STS-121 (Discovery), LC39A, KSC – 7 person crew, ISS mission, ISS Logistics, Testing of repair techniques for TPS.  Crew: Steven Lindsay, Mark Kelly, Michael Fossum, Lisa Nowak, Stephanie Wilson, Piers Sellers, Thomas Reiter (To ISS – ESA/German Expedition 13). No crew member return from ISS.
